2018 Supreme(Mad) 195

IN THE HIGH COURT OF JUDICATURE AT MADRAS
G. JAYACHANDRAN, J.
V. Palanivel & Others - Appellant
Versus
State by Inspector of Police, Represented by the Inspector of Police, SPE, CBI, ACB, Chennai - Respondents
Criminal Appeal Nos. 272, 284 & 297 of 2009
Decided On : 23-01-2018

Advocates Appeared:
For the Appellants : V. Ramana Reddy, N.R. Anantha Ramakrishnan, A.V. Somasundaram for M/s. Lakshmi Priya Associates
For the Respondent: K. Srinivasan

The main legal point established in the judgment is the confirmation of the conviction of the accused based on evidence of forgery, impersonation, and misuse of loan funds.

Headnote:

Forgery - Loan Fraud - IPC 420, 467, 468, 471, 120-B, PC Act 1988 - The judgment discusses the fraudulent loan scheme involving fabrication of documents, impersonation, and misuse of loan amount. The court confirmed the conviction of the accused based on evidence of forgery, impersonation, and misuse of loan funds.

Fact of the Case:

The appellants were convicted for their involvement in a fraudulent loan scheme, including fabrication of documents, impersonation, and misuse of loan funds. The trial court found them guilty and imposed sentences based on the charges.

Finding of the Court:

The court found the accused guilty of forgery, impersonation, and misuse of loan funds based on evidence presented by the prosecution. The court confirmed the conviction and modified the sentences based on the charges.

Issues: The issues involved the fraudulent loan scheme, including fabrication of documents, impersonation, and misuse of loan funds. The court considered the evidence presented by the prosecution and the arguments raised by the appellants.

Ratio Decidendi: The court relied on the evidence of forgery, impersonation, and misuse of loan funds to confirm the conviction of the accused. The court also considered the settlement of the loan amount and modified the sentences accordingly.

Final Decision: The court confirmed the conviction of the accused and modified the sentences based on the charges. The sentences imposed by the court were ordered to run concurrently, and the period of imprisonment already undergone was set off.

JUDGMENT :

1. These appeals are arising out of the conviction against the appellants passed by the learned XI Additional Judge, CBI Cases, Chennai dated 19.05.2009 in C.C.No.64 of 2004.

2. Brief facts leading to these appeals are as follows:

J.S. Prabhu [A1] while functioning as Branch Manager, in charge of Corporation Bank, Tambaram Branch, Sanatorium during the year 1999-2000, had conspired with Palanivel [A2], Gunasekaran [A3], Thriumurthy [A4]. T.N. Ravi [A5] and D.Rajendran (died on 08.01.2006) pending trial to do illegal act of fabricating the records used it as genuine document and extent the loan in the name of M/s Super Cool AC Industries represented by its Proprietor Thirumurthy[A4] and thereby cheated the bank to the tune of Rs.3lakhs. In pursuant to the said conspiracy, the documents, such as title deed, chitta, patta, encumbrance certificate and valuation certificate were fabricated. A6[D.Rajedran] by impersonating himself as K.P. Rajendran, had signed as guarantor for the loan extended to non-existing firm M/s Super Cool AC Industries at No.3, TNHB Plot, Tambaram-Sanatorium and he had connivance with A2[Palanivel] produced valuation certificate for the property at S.No.251/2 at Uthukottai, which consists of 1400 sq.ft. A5[T.N. Ravi-Valuer] who is the appellant in Cr.A.No.269 of 2009 died on 08.01.2006. Hence, charges against him got abated.

3. Based on the complaint given by the Assistant Regional Manager, Shri.Sudhakar N.Bhat, CBI has taken up the investigation and has filed final report, which has been taken cognizance of offence by the trial Court under C.C.Nos.61 to 66 of 2009. Each case involves different loan transaction in the name of non-existing person or firm. The present appeals arise out of C.C.No.64 of 2004 with regard to CORP VYAPAR loan extended to M/s Super Cool AC Industries represented by its Proprietor Thirumurthy[A4].

4. The Specific charge against A1[J.S.Prabhu] is that he along with other accused has extended loan to M/s Super Cool AC Industries at No.3, TNHB Plot, Tambaram-Sanatorium, Chennai-45, which is a non-existing firm and the documents furnished along with the loan application are fabricated by A2[V.Palanivel] and A3[D.Gunasekaran]. The rubber seal found in the patta, encumbrance certificate, house tax receipt, adangal are fake and the rubber seals were procured by A3[D.Gunasekaran]through rubber stamp maker Mr.G.Panchacharam, who was examined as PW-15. A1[J.S.Prabhu] as Branch Manager ought to have conducted pre-sanction inspection and post-sanction inspection of the borrower premises as well as property shown as collateral security. But, he has failed to do so in order to extend the loan to the fictitious firm, which is not in existence at No.3, TNHB Plot, Tambaram-Sanaorium. The property shown as collateral security does not have a building upon it. However, A1[J.S. Prabhu] has accepted the house tax receipt, encumbrance certificate, patta and adangal as if the property stands in the name of K.P. Rajendran and the value of the property is to be accepted as collateral security. The deceased 6th accused [D.Rajendran] has impersonated himself as guarantor K.P. Rajendran and the same was not verified by A1[J.S.Prabhu] and he had not created equitable mortgage immediately at the time of disbursement of loan. Further, A1 [J.S. Prabhu] has procured A2[Palanivel] to withdraw the entire loan amount sanctioned and credited into the account of M/s Super Cool AC Industries.

5. As far as A2[Palanivel] is concerned, he has arranged fake documents, fake guarantor and opened an account in the name of M/s Super Cool AC Industries by inducing one Mr. E.Chandra Mohan, for introducing the account.
